Output 89d11636427ad289c2b65fb8cfba8957c3a6ab6bd8e5d70de4fcde4cc50e0d64:2

value
4227543
script pubkey
OP_0 OP_PUSHBYTES_20 917c0d018f490ceb4d9ee40f8e3128b16770aafd
address
bc1qj97q6qv0fyxwknv7us8cuvfgk9nhp2hayn8g5v
transaction
89d11636427ad289c2b65fb8cfba8957c3a6ab6bd8e5d70de4fcde4cc50e0d64
spent
true